Python是一種高級編程語言,它有很多強大的工具庫,其中一個重要的工具庫是NumPy,NumPy是Python的數值計算擴展庫。在NumPy中,我們可以使用矩形類(Rectangle)來計算矩形的周長。
class Rectangle: def __init__(self, length, width): self.length = length self.width = width def perimeter(self): return 2 * (self.length + self.width) # 創建一個矩形對象 rect = Rectangle(5, 10) # 計算矩形的周長 perimeter = rect.perimeter() # 打印周長 print("矩形的周長為:", perimeter)
在上面的代碼中,我們定義了一個矩形類,使用self關鍵字來初始化矩形的長度和寬度。然后我們實現了一個計算周長的函數perimeter(),它基于矩形的長度和寬度計算出矩形的周長。
接下來,我們創建了一個矩形對象rect,使用5和10作為它的長度和寬度。然后,我們調用了矩形對象的perimeter()函數,將返回矩形的周長。最后,我們使用print()函數輸出矩形的周長。
總之,Python的矩形類(Rectangle)是一個非常有用的工具,它可以幫助我們計算矩形的周長。如果你對Python編程感興趣,那么學習矩形類是一個很好的開始。